Object of this paper is the feasibility study, technical and economic, of an electric public transport service where fast charge stations are equipped with electrical energy storage composed by batteries and/or supercapacitor, with relative power electronics, management and control, in order to improve the technical- economical dimensioning, for different possible operating conditions. To this purpose, referring to a real case, a simulator of the charging station was made, including storage subsystems and converters. The final goal is optimizing the storage system necessary to guarantee the charging with a smoother, more levelled supply from the network. © 2017 MOBI - Mobility, Logistics and Automotive Technology Research Centre.
